Came here a couple weeks ago for a lunch meeting. It's the type of place where you order at the counter and then sit down which is fine. The design is just interesting because the counter is right when you walk in so everyone has to line up outside to order. It makes it seem like there's a huge wait but really it might just be a few people in front of your to order. Just something to keep in mind. Cute ambiance and atmosphere - half indoor and outdoor. Large menu with lots of choices. I got the turkey croissant sandwich with sweet potato fries. I took a star off because the person I was with ordered sweet potato fries as well and got regular fries. Also thought he was getting an actual tuna sandwich when he ordered the albacore tuna sandwich but it turned out to be a tuna SALAD sandwich. Other than that - great casual lunch spot!

We love this place! There's enough variety for a vegan, vegetarian and them carnivores. I love their tofu dishes, their creative spinach salad, and the veggie wrap. They used to sell wine and beer (I think) but this time they only had mimosa drinks. We had to move two table together to make enough space for our group, but it all worked. This place can get busy and crowded, but we were there after the lunch crowd. Swami's does stop taking orders by 3pm but they didn't mind if we sat there beyond that time. We return to this place at least once every time we are in O'side.
